/en/
en
true
1565
1102
47356
5
Chicago
chicago
79
Chicago
41.866865
2530
45726
-87.734855
11
2297
43934
false
61
1,3,8,9
594
12545
294
202
2
2252
7247
$
1761833
Map
Street ViewExplore
AddressSheffer Rd, 1261